Turns out the BBC have got hold of Brian Conley again, and he's now making is offical TV comeback with what seems to be a new variety show for daytimes on BBC Two.
Let Me Entertain You could be what we are looking for besides music and dancing. The show sees all-comers performing infront of a studio audience doing whatever they want for a £1000 cash prize. Looks to me like a modern day Oppertunity Knocks. I'd say it worth a watch for any variety fans.
